Y = 4x + 1....slope here is 4. A parallel line will have the same slope
y = mx + b
slope(m) = 4
(3,9)...x = 3 and y = 9
now we sub and find b, the y int
9 = 4(3) + b
9 = 12 + b
9 - 12 = b
-3 = b
so ur parallel equation is : y = 4x - 3
